All warnings (new ones prefixed by >>):

>> drivers/pci/pcie/portdrv.c:86: warning: This comment starts with '/**', but isn't a kernel-doc comment. Refer Documentation/doc-guide/kernel-doc.rst
    * Determine if device supports Inter switch P2P links.


vim +86 drivers/pci/pcie/portdrv.c

    84	
    85	/**
  > 86	 * Determine if device supports Inter switch P2P links.
    87	 *
    88	 * Return value: true if inter switch P2P is supported, return false otherwise.
    89	 */
    90	static bool pcie_port_is_p2p_supported(struct pci_dev *dev)
    91	{
    92		/* P2P link attribute is supported on upstream ports only */
    93		if (pci_pcie_type(dev) != PCI_EXP_TYPE_UPSTREAM)
    94			return false;
    95	
    96		/*
    97		 * Currently Broadcom PEX switches are supported.
    98		 */
    99		if (dev->vendor == PCI_VENDOR_ID_LSI_LOGIC &&
   100		    (dev->device == PCI_DEVICE_ID_BRCM_PEX_89000_HLC ||
   101		     dev->device == PCI_DEVICE_ID_BRCM_PEX_89000_LLC))
   102			return pcie_brcm_is_p2p_supported(dev);
   103	
   104		return false;
   105	}
   106
